NEW YORK CITY POWERBOAT RALLY 2003



Top Ten Boats to the Tappan Zee Bridge:



1. Jim Leonardo Extreme Exhibit 50’ Nor-Tech Cat 4-1500HP’s

2. Bob Christie Perfect Storm 36’ Nor-Tech Cat 2-1000HP’s

3. Jim Courtney 36’ Nor-Tech Cat 2-850HP’s

4. Charlie Amorosi Tsunami 36’ Spectre Cat 2-650 ProRoc’s

5. Scott Applegate Jus Truckin’ 42’ Outerlimits GTX 2-1200HP’s

6. Oliver Bock Wet N Wild 47’ Outerlimits GTX 2-1250HP’s

7. Barry Myers Category 4 36’ Skater Cat 2-825HP’s

8. Brad Benson Pass Blocker 42’ Outerlimits 2-900HP’s

9. Charlie Tesauro Team Fith 28’ Skater Cat 2-Merc 300 OB’s

10. Bob Leach Eliminator 36’ Eliminator Cat 2-500HP’s

Ron P 06-17-2003 10:07 AM

I guess this particular poker run is new to most of you. Each year this poker run turns in to a 16 mile drag race from the George Washington Bridge to the Tappen Zee bridge. There are two winners of the drag race. One in the Cat class and one in the V bottom class.

First Cat and first V to go under the Tappan Zee wins the honor of begin called King of the Hudson.

Yes, there are two Kings. Maybe that's the confusion.

lightningmike 06-17-2003 10:43 AM

I agree there are two kings, V's and Cats. It is amazing the hardware that shows up. Especially the big powered Outer Limits! But is does seem a number of them break down thru out the run....but the are extremely fast when running.

I throttle for Bob Leach in the 36 Eliminator, and we never thought we would finish any better then the top 25. We were only running stock HP500EFI's, we were 10th to the bridge, but actually 8th to the first card stop, then finished 7th overall to Liberty Marina. Again......little old stock horsepower....most of the top 6 other boats out powered us by 1,000hp, with the 6th place boat being the Pro-Roc spectre having 360HP on us....we felt pretty good to do as well as we did with all the big players out there! When I say finished 7th, all 5 boats were within 200 yards of us, with exception to the 50 Nortech w/ Quads...wow!

We will definitely be back next year with big power...probably not quite enough to be King, but move up a few slots!
